Page 18 - Issue280
P. 18
280
ـه1446 لوألا عيبر ددـــــ ـــــعلا Forum 18
م2024 برمتبس�
AI and Information Security
Summer Bootcamp 2024
The Data Science Club Artificial Intelligence and Data Analytics protect information in an increasingly digital world. To keep
(AIDA) Lab at the College of Computer and Information attendees updated on the latest developments in cryptography,
Sciences, Prince Sultan University, conducted a first-of-its-kind the sessions also included discussions on emerging trends and
AI and Information Security Summer Bootcamp 2024, aimed technologies.
at enhancing the participants' skills and giving them hands-on
experience with up-to-date AI tools. Session 4: Mastering Generative AI with Langchain by Dr. Tariq
The Tech Summer Bootcamp was free of cost for students, faculty Mehmood
and the community. It was an excellent opportunity to learn This session delved into the fundamentals of AI and its role in
new skills, knowledge and explore new career paths in the tech developing scalable models. Key aspects of generative AI, such
industry. Boot camp ran from August 4 to 7, 2024, featuring four as creating new content by learning patterns from existing
sessions, each lasting three hours. data, and its applications in media, entertainment, and product
design were discussed. The architecture of generative models,
Session 1: Introduction to AI and Information Security, Current such as RNNs, transformers, and BERT, was also discussed. The
and Emerging Technologies by Dr. Amjad Rehman open-source Python framework, LangChain, was emphasized for
This session was an introduction to AI Fundamentals where building LLM-powered applications.
basic concepts of AI, including machine learning, deep learning, Attendees were guided through setting up the development
and neural networks were discussed. AI applications in various environment, integrating APIs, and using prompt engineering
industries and the implications of these technologies were techniques. Key components of the LangChain framework, such
demonstrated. Overview of information security principles, as prompt templates, vector stores, indexes, retrievers, and
including confidentiality, integrity, and availability was delivered. agents, were discussed. The bootcamp concluded with a recap of
Discussion on the latest AI tools and platforms were the the setup process, application building, and essential resources
main highlights. Future trends in cybersecurity, like AI-driven for working with generative AI.
security solutions, blockchain for security, were explained.
Overall, objectives and workshops details were shared with the Participants’ Feedback
participants. The attendees of the Tech Summer Bootcamp had a positive and
rewarding experience, according to their reviews and feedback.
Session 2: Practical Training in Unstructured Text Preprocessing Here are some of the comments they shared:
and Sentiment Analysis by Mr. Muhammed Mujahid
This session provided participants with a comprehensive ● “This program has been a fantastic journey, deepening my
understanding of unstructured text preprocessing and sentiment understanding of natural language processing NLP, cryptography
analysis, equipping them with essential skills for natural language with Python and Mastering LangChain, I've gained valuable
processing (NLP). The training covered key techniques such insights and hands-on experience that I’m eager to learn more
as tokenization, stemming, and text normalization, along with about it.” – SE Student
practical application using tools like TextBlob for sentiment
classification. Participants engaged in hands-on projects, working ● “The Tech Summer Bootcamp was an amazing opportunity to
with real-world datasets to solidify their understanding of these network with other tech enthusiasts and professionals. I learned
concepts. a lot from the sessions, especially the one on Cryptography with
The session also guided them in designing a mini app for Python: Securing Data in the Digital Age”– Faculty
sentiment analysis, demonstrating the practical implementation ● “The Tech Summer Bootcamp was a valuable investment for
of their skills. By the end of the bootcamp, attendees were well- me. "The Tech Summer Bootcamp was a valuable investment for
prepared to tackle projects involving unstructured text data, me. The experience provided valuable insights into Generative
including sentiment analysis, customer reviews, topic modeling, AI, Security Applications, Cryptography, NLP, LLMs and their
spam detection, emotion analysis, and chatbot creation. The application in real-world problems. Having been interested in
workshop successfully enhanced their NLP capabilities, enabling this field for some time, this bootcamp served as my first step
them to apply their knowledge effectively in real-world scenarios. into the world of Generative AI and Data Analytics. I’m grateful
to the AIDA Lab team for organizing such a comprehensive and
Session 3: Cryptography with Python: Securing Data in the engaging program.” – CS Intern
Digital Age by Dr. Khalid Haseeb
This session offered valuable insights for Cryptography and ● “I had an amazing experience at the Summer Bootcamp,
Information Security in terms of digital information protections especially during the "Mastering Generative AI with LangChain"
and devices authentication. Attendees acquired a profound session. It was highly interactive and engaging, offering a deep
comprehension of essential cryptographic techniques, such as dive into the fundamentals of generative AI. The practical steps
encryption/decryption algorithms, key management, hashing for API integration and environment setup were incredibly
algorithms and digital signature practices using Python. The valuable, equipping us with the skills to build and deploy AI-
training also emphasized the significance of Python for creating powered applications efficiently.” – CS Student
secure applications and putting cryptographic algorithms into
practice. To effectively incorporate cryptographic solutions into
their projects, participants learned how to use Python libraries
and tools.
The session also addressed contemporary issues in information
security, including safeguarding against cyber-attacks and ensuring
the integrity of data. The practical applications of cryptographic
methods using programming skills were demonstrated through
hands-on exercises, which effectively improved the attendees'
skills in real-world scenarios. The training enhances the abilities
of participants in securing digital communications and protecting
sensitive information effectively over the insecure IT/business
environment. In general, the workshop successfully provided
participants with the knowledge and tools they needed to